피드로 돌아가기
Dev.toAI/ML
원문 읽기
Regex 버그로 인한 오판 방지 및 27시간의 리소스 낭비 차단
50% Compliance, Not 0%: How a Logging Spike Almost Triggered the Wrong Architecture Rewrite
AI 요약
Context
Prompt Augmentation 트랙의 Compliance 수치가 0%로 측정됨에 따라 시스템 전체 결함으로 판단. 이로 인해 Plan-and-Execute 아키텍처의 전면적인 재작성(Rewrite)을 검토한 상황.
Technical Solution
- 데이터 수집 단계의 Regex 파싱 로직 내 False-Negative 발생 지점 식별
- 실제 Compliance 수치(50%)와 로깅 시스템의 측정값(0%) 간의 괴리를 분석한 Spike Methodology 적용
- 로그 분석 결과에 기반한 아키텍처 재작성 결정 보류 및 로직 수정으로 방향 전환
- Chrome GPU Deadlock 진단을 통한 런타임 환경의 병목 지점 제거
- 정규표현식 검증 프로세스 강화를 통한 데이터 무결성 확보
Impact
잘못된 아키텍처 리라이트에 소요될 뻔한 27시간의 개발 공수 절감.
실천 포인트
1. 지표의 극단적 수치(0% 등) 발견 시 로직 수정 전 측정 도구(Regex, Monitoring)의 정밀도 우선 검증
2. 대규모 아키텍처 변경 전 Spike 테스트를 통한 가설 검증 단계 필수 포함
3. 데이터 파싱 단계의 False-Negative 가능성을 고려한 테스트 케이스 설계